Gasoline Engine Specs

The all-new 2021 BMW X1 comes with a few engine options. A 2.0-liter turbo-four engine comes as standard, and it provides 228 horsepower. With this output, X1 SUV accelerates from 0 to 60 mph in 6.3 seconds. A front-wheel-drive setup is standard, but you can load an optional all-wheel-drive system. Ride quality is superb, and the X1 model comes with a quiet ride and impressive handling.

2021 X1 xDrive25e

One of the best things about the 2021 BMW X1 model is its plug-in hybrid variant. This version won’t depart from the gasoline-powered X1 in terms of design. This variant comes with a 1.5-liter turbo engine.

BMW will pair this output with an electric motor and a 9.7 kWh lithium-ion battery pack. The battery is placed under the rear seats. The X1 xDriver25e will produce 217 hp and 284 lb-ft of torque. The plug-in hybrid comes with a 120 mph of top speed, and it sprints from 0 to 60 mph in seven seconds flat. AWD configuration is standard and all-electric range has been rated at 31 miles.

2021 BMW X1 Price and Release Date

The forthcoming 2021 BMW X1 will once again cost around $35,000. The upper trim levels will cost more, over $42,000. As we said, this model competes with other crossovers and SUVs in the premium segment.

Some of the rivals are Lincoln MKC, Mercedes-Benz GLA, and Lexus NX. The sales will start by the end of 2020. However, X1 SUV will reach American soil in the first half of 2021.
